About This Role

This role involves supporting the Power Delivery team by completing day-to-day project tasks for successful project delivery, with a focus on transmission line design using PLS-CADD and PLS-POLE.

Responsibilities

  • Complete day-to-day project tasks as required for successful project delivery
  • Prepare Specification Packages, Structural and Fabrication Drawings
  • Design and analyze Transmission Lines using PLS-CADD and PLS-POLE
  • Design and analyze foundations
  • Analyze existing and proposed structures with regard to Client and other required codes, standards, and specifications
  • Perform Electrical Clearance checks and calculations
  • Coordinate and develop permits for Railroads, Roadways, and Environmental Crossings
  • Apply engineering principles to assist in the design of Power Delivery Projects
  • Implement effective engineering methods, provide technical guidance, and act as a resource for engineers and designers
  • Assist in quality control and quality assurance of active projects, providing peer reviews
